diff --git a/roles/vault/defaults/main.yml b/roles/vault/defaults/main.yml
index 00cd4b7d09670b845fc4feb3debb2442364fea69..4eb055f7e1362e8113c0e76dceeafa8b36911e00 100644
--- a/roles/vault/defaults/main.yml
+++ b/roles/vault/defaults/main.yml
@@ -166,7 +166,7 @@ vault_pki_mounts:
           organization: "system:node-proxier"
       - name: front-proxy-client
         group: k8s-cluster
-        password: "{{ lookup('password', 'credentials/vault/kube-proxy length=15') }}"
+        password: "{{ lookup('password', inventory_dir + '/credentials/vault/kube-proxy length=15') }}"
         policy_rules: default
         role_options:
           allow_any_name: true